Polish biotech company Urteste (搜索) S.A. announced plans to initiate clinical trials for its innovative pancreatic cancer (搜索) diagnostic test in the European Union during the third quarter of 2025. The trials will evaluate the Panuri (搜索) test, which detects cancer through enzyme activity measurement in urine samples.
The European certification study will involve 550 patients across Poland and other selected EU countries. Urteste (搜索) is currently preparing the trial protocol in collaboration with Avania (搜索) and will announce a tender in Q2 2025 to select a Contract Research Organization (CRO) to oversee the clinical trials.
"We plan to begin clinical trials for the Panuri (搜索) test in Europe in Q3 of this year. The study will be simpler, faster, and more cost-effective than the U.S. trial, but its significance will be substantial," said Grzegorz Stefański, CEO and Co-founder of Urteste (搜索) S.A. "Conducting this trial will enable us to seek certification in Europe. We will also obtain preliminary results sooner, marking a major milestone that brings us closer to commercializing our technology."
Parallel U.S. Regulatory Strategy
While preparing for European trials, Urteste (搜索) is simultaneously advancing its U.S. regulatory pathway. The company has scheduled its fourth Q-submission meeting with the FDA for mid-2025, which will serve as the final discussion regarding study design before initiating clinical trials in the United States.
"Our three previous meetings with the FDA have been very positive, helping us better understand regulatory expectations, which is crucial for demonstrating the diagnostic value of our test and achieving a smooth registration process in the U.S.," Stefański noted. The remaining issue to be determined is the number of patients required for the U.S. trial.
By mid-2025, Urteste (搜索) expects to complete the internal validation of the Panuri (搜索) test, which will be used in both European and U.S. clinical trials.
Novel Urine-Based Cancer Detection Technology
Urteste (搜索)'s diagnostic platform represents a potentially significant advancement in early cancer detection. The technology measures the activity of specific enzymes present in urine samples, with changes in urine color intensity potentially indicating the presence of cancer.
The simplicity of urine sample collection could offer advantages over more invasive diagnostic procedures, particularly for cancers like pancreatic cancer (搜索) that are often diagnosed at advanced stages due to vague early symptoms and challenging detection.
Broad Cancer Detection Portfolio
Beyond pancreatic cancer (搜索), Urteste (搜索) has developed 12 prototype diagnostic tests targeting various cancer types, including breast, brain, stomach, bile ducts, ovary, endometrium, kidney, colorectal, lung, liver, and prostate cancers. Collectively, these cancers account for approximately 70% of global cancer-related deaths.
The company's focus on early detection aligns with its motto, "Early cancer detection saves lives," addressing a critical need in cancer care where survival rates typically improve significantly with earlier diagnosis.
Market and Clinical Significance
Pancreatic cancer (搜索) represents a particularly urgent area of diagnostic need. With a five-year survival rate of approximately 10%, it remains one of the deadliest forms of cancer. Early detection methods could dramatically improve patient outcomes by enabling treatment before the disease progresses to advanced stages.
If successful in clinical trials, Urteste (搜索)'s non-invasive urine test could potentially transform the pancreatic cancer (搜索) diagnostic landscape, offering a simple screening method that could be implemented more broadly than current diagnostic approaches.
The company, which trades on the Warsaw Stock Exchange under the ticker URT, has assembled a team of managers with extensive experience in medical companies and scientists specialized in proteolytic enzymes (搜索) and peptide chemistry to advance its diagnostic platform toward commercialization.
